What is an Article of Organization?

An Article of Organization, also known as an LLC certificate or Certificate of Formation in some states, is a document filed with the secretary of state to form an LLC.

Each state has a different requirement to fill out a form. An Article of Organization usually includes the following:

  • The name of the LLC,
  • the effective date of the LLC,
  • the company’s principal office,
  • the business purpose,
  • the duration of the business, 
  • a copy of the LLC’s name registration certificate, and
  • the name and address of the registered agent, organizers, and
  • at least one member of the company.

You can file an Article of Organization online, by mail, or in person.

Filing Maryland Articles of Organization Online

Time needed: 5 minutes.

The State office offers a standard application form on their website for the filing process. Once approved, you shall receive a certified copy of your Maryland LLC Articles of Organization. The State offers filing of Articles through online mode, or via mail. The formation guide in the following steps will help you file for the articles of the organization so read on and get the info.

  1. Visit the official website of the State of Maryland

    The Maryland Department of Assessments and Taxation brings a one-stop solution to every business information. Visit the Official State’s Registration and Filings page to learn more about filing the required documents for your business.maryland-articles-of-organization-step1

  2. Create your Account

    If you already registered your account on the website, press on the “login” option and proceed to fill in your login credentials and access your account. If you do not have an account, click on the “Create Account” option on the page.maryland-articles-of-organization-step2

  3. Fill in Your Details

    On the sign-up page, enter information to create a new account such as your First and Last name, Contact details, Email, Address, ZIP Code, and password. After creating your account credentials, you will be required to answer additional questions. Next, click on the tab “Create Account”.
    maryland-articles-of-organization-step3

  4. Proceed with the Registration

    After confirmation of your Account on the State website, log in with your username and password. Once logged in, select the “Start a New Filing” option on the Homepage of your Account. Next, select the type of your business “Maryland Limited Liability Company” from the given list in the drop-down menu.
    maryland-articles-of-organization-step4

  5. Complete the registration process

    After the registration page for your Maryland LLC opens up, continue with the registration process by filling in the application for Articles of Organization. The processing period for online filing is within 7 business days.

Filing Maryland Articles of Organization by Mail

If you wish to file your Articles of Organization via mail, read the instructions below to learn more about drafting a suitable article of the organization as per the requirements of the State.

  1. Visit the Department Forms and Applications page on the State of Maryland website.
  2. Scroll down to find the option “Create or Start a Business in Maryland”.
  3. Click on the following link under the heading “Articles of Organization for Limited Liability Company form and instructions”.
  4. Download the Application form PDF on the navigated page.
  5. You can download the form and fill it in on your system and then print it. The State office does not accept forms in handwritten form.
  6. Make payment by cheque for $100.00 in the name of the State Department of Assessments and Taxation.
  7. For submitting by mail or in-person, file your documents to the following address: State Department of Assessments and Taxation, Charter Division 301 W. Preston Street; 8th Floor Baltimore, MD 21201-2395
